About

OUTFRONT Media Inc. is one of the largest and most trusted out-of-home media companies in the U.S., helping brands connect with audiences in the moments and environments that matter most. As OUTFRONT evolves, it’s defining a new era of in-real-life marketing, turning public spaces into platforms for creativity, connection, and cultural relevance. With a nationwide footprint across billboards, digital displays, transit systems, and other out-of-home formats, OUTFRONT turns creative into powerful real-world experiences. Its in-house agency, OUTFRONT STUDIOS, and award-winning innovation team, XLabs, deliver standout storytelling, supported by advanced technology and data tools that can drive measurable impact. OUTFRONT Media Inc. was established in 2013 and was incorporated in Maryland.

📊 MIXED OUTFRONT Media Q1 2026: Revenues up 10%, OIBDA up 56% to ~$100 million, AFFO doubles to $61 million
Revenue & Profitability
Consolidated revenues grew 10% year-over-year in Q1 2026. Billboard revenues rose 7.1% (or over 4% excluding condemnations and a large LA contract exit). Transit revenues grew 22%. Consolidated adjusted OIBDA was approximately $100 million, up 56%. AFFO more than doubled to $61 million. Billboard adjusted OIBDA increased 18% (or 4% excluding condemnations). Transit adjusted OIBDA improved by about $13 million to a loss of just over $1 million.
Outlook
Management noted strong demand continuing into spring and summer. They expect Q2 2026 revenue growth to accelerate to over 10% year-over-year, driven by about 30% growth in transit and mid-single-digit billboard growth. The U.S. hosting the World Cup in June-July 2026 is expected to provide a benefit. The industry is working on measurement improvements through OAAA and Geopath.
Growth Drivers
Key growth drivers include the New York MTA transit contract (up over 26% in Q1), digital billboard conversion (14 new digital conversions in Q1, 125 expected for full year), programmatic and automated sales (up nearly 40% to 20% of digital revenue), and strong performance in tech and legal categories. The company noted strength in the San Francisco market driven by AI-related companies.
Balance Sheet & CapEx
Q1 2026 CapEx was about $24 million, including $7 million of maintenance. The company expects full-year 2026 CapEx of approximately $90 million, with $30-35 million for maintenance. Investments include technology upgrades (CRM, training modules, AdQuick partnership), new digital billboard conversions (125 expected for the year), and process improvements with a success-based consultant.
Margins
Consolidated adjusted OIBDA margin improved significantly in Q1, with OIBDA up 56% on 10% revenue growth. Billboard OIBDA increased 18% (or 4% excluding condemnations), driven by revenue growth outpacing expense growth. Transit OIBDA improved by $13 million to a loss of just over $1 million. Corporate expenses declined by about $6 million. Management expects AFFO to grow in the mid-teens for full-year 2026.
Key Risks
Not explicitly discussed in this earnings call. However, the transcript mentions a large marginally profitable billboard contract in Los Angeles that the company exited, and the condemnation revenue in Q1 was highlighted as a notable item. The MTA contract recoupment structure carries accounting complexity.

📞 Earnings Call Transcripts (5)
Q2 2026 Q2 2026 2026-08-05
Second quarter revenue grew 14% year-over-year, driven by strong transit and billboard performance, with World Cup campaigns contributing over $35 million. Adjusted OIBDA rose 29% and AFFO 45%, while digital and programmatic revenues accelerated. Guidance calls for continued high single-digit revenue growth and AFFO up over 20% for 2026.
Q1 2026 Q1 2026 2026-05-07
First quarter 2026 saw 10% revenue growth, 56% higher adjusted OIBDA, and strong transit and digital gains. Outlook remains positive with Q2 revenue growth expected to exceed 10%, supported by World Cup and tech sector momentum.
Q4 2025 Q4 2025 2026-02-25
Q4 2025 saw 4.1% revenue growth, led by transit and digital gains, with adjusted OIBDA up 12%. Strategic exits and digital investments drove margin expansion, and strong momentum is expected to continue into 2026, supported by the MTA, World Cup, and new tech partnerships.
Q3 2025 Q3 2025 2025-11-06
Q3 results surpassed expectations with 3.45% revenue growth, led by a 24% surge in Transit and strong digital gains. AFFO guidance for 2025 was raised, and refinancing improved liquidity and extended debt maturities. Major events and strategic partnerships are expected to drive future growth.
Q2 2025 Q2 2025 2025-08-05
Revenue and AFFO were flat to slightly up, with transit and digital segments showing growth while billboard revenues declined due to strategic contract exits. Cost reductions and restructuring are expected to drive margin expansion and mid-single-digit AFFO growth for 2025.

Financial Model
Projections are built from each company's audited annual financials (Income Statement, Balance Sheet, Cash Flow) over the last 5 fiscal years. Forward assumptions — revenue growth %, EBITDA margin, D&A (USD millions), interest expense, tax rate, and capex — are AI-generated using historical context and refreshed twice a year: after the December results season and after the September/Q4 results season.

DCF Valuation
Fair Value = Σ(FCFt / (1+WACC)t) + Terminal Value. Terminal Value uses the Gordon Growth Model: FCF5 × (1+g) / (WACC−g). Default WACC: 10% (US risk-free ~4.5%, equity risk premium ~5.5%). Default terminal growth: 3% (long-run US nominal GDP proxy).

CAGR Tracker
Expected 5-year CAGR = (DCF Fair Value / Current Price)1/5 − 1. Assumes fair value is reached in exactly 5 years — a mechanical estimate only.
